Senior Embedded Software Engineer
Rockwell Automation
Katowice
1 d. temu

Job Description

The Motion Business is a fast-growing part of Rockwell Automation that develops motion control products such as servo drives, servo motors, and independent cart systems for use in industrial applications.

The most common market for these products are in factory automation applications such as packaging machinery, paper converting, printing, web handling, and automated assembly.

Join a global, cross-functional team that provides passionate, world-class service and valued solutions to our customers.

We need a Senior Embedded Software Engineer who can work on anomaly resolution (70%), quality improvement (20%), and feature enhancement (10%) projects.

The right candidate will have a proven track record of quickly learning complex embedded systems and delivering solutions in a dynamic, fast paced environment.

This will involve hands-on work in the laboratory to replicate customer systems, understanding firmware source code, identifying root cause, modifying the source code, testing and validating the features and releasing them for customers.

This is a great role for an engineer who enjoys continuous learning and is driven by the immediate impact their work would have on the countless lives of our customers across the globe.

There will be plenty of opportunities to grow and showcase your technical and leadership abilities.

Within 1 Month, You’ll :

  • Meet your new team, located in the USA and Poland.
  • Complete the onboarding program, which gives an overview of the tools and process used in our team and the products we own.
  • Set up your lab space with Rockwell Automation Controllers, Drives and Motors and gain hands-on experience with our technologies
  • Within 3 Months, You’ll :

  • Be familiar with our build tools, development environment and coding practices.
  • Work on your first customer-found anomaly, including reproducing the problem, identifying the root cause, designing and implementing a fix and creating a build ready for release.
  • Within 6 Months, You’ll :

  • Help resolve a customer-critical anomaly, working directly with Rockwell Automation field engineers and customer representatives.
  • Have a well-oiled working pattern established for handling requests from the various teams we interface with, including product management, product quality, productivity and customer technical support.
  • Write how-to documents to record your learnings for other engineers to benefit from.
  • Within 12 Months & beyond, You’ll :

  • Be a subject matter expert for a particular feature in the code or a particular product.
  • Own the planning, implementation, testing and release of a drive firmware product.
  • Continue expanding your technical expertise and take on more leadership responsibilities.
  • Minimum Qualifications

  • Bachelor’s Degree in Electrical Engineering, Computer Science, Software Engineering, or equivalent.
  • 5+ years of real-time embedded firmware development using C / C++.
  • Experience working in a lab environment including use of firmware debug tools such as a JTAG debugger and laboratory equipment such as oscilloscopes.
  • Experience analyzing and solving complex problems which involve both firmware and hardware.
  • Strong verbal and written communication skills.
  • Preferred Qualifications

  • Experience with motion control systems and / or industrial automation products and programming environments.
  • Experience in collaborating with cross-functional, global technical teams.
  • Has a passion for writing high quality, clean & readable code.
  • Quick-learning self-starter who works well with a dynamic team.
  • Technical leadership experience.
  • This position is part of a job family. Experience is the determining factor.

    Zgłoś tę pracę
    checkmark

    Thank you for reporting this job!

    Your feedback will help us improve the quality of our services.

    Aplikuj
    Mój adres email
    Klikając przycisk "Kontynuuj", wyrażam zgodę neuvoo na przetwarzanie moich danych i wysyłanie powiadomień e-mailem, zgodnie z zasadami przedstawionymi przez neuvoo. W każdej chwili mogę wycofać moją zgodę lub zrezygnować z subskrypcji.
    Kontynuuj
    Formularz wniosku